Marco Lijoi – Guitar Maker
Early Fascination with Music and Wood
My journey into the world of music began at the age of four when I was introduced to the classical guitar through the Suzuki Method. As I grew older, my fascination with both wood and music continued to flourish, eventually guiding me toward a path where these passions merged into the art of guitar making.
Academic Background and Discovery of Luthiery
After completing my classical high school education and spending a year studying physics at the University of Turin, I felt a strong desire to unite the scientific world of physics with the artistic realms of music and craftsmanship. This calling led me to a one-year guitar-making course under the guidance of esteemed luthier Aldo Illotta in Biella.
Formal Training in Milan
The following year, I pursued further excellence in guitar craftsmanship by enrolling at the Civica Scuola di Liuteria in Milan. Here, I had the privilege of learning from some of Italy’s finest guitar makers. Over four years, I refined my skills and absorbed the knowledge and techniques passed down through generations.
My dedication culminated in earning my diploma as a master guitar maker – a milestone that propelled me into a world of creativity, innovation, and refined craftsmanship.
Professional Experience and Personal Workshop
During my studies at the Civica Scuola di Liuteria, I also embarked on a new chapter by founding my own business. This marked my formal entry into professional guitar making, where I could channel my passion, expertise, and creativity into crafting exceptional instruments.
In addition, I had the opportunity to work for two years at Salvi, a renowned harp manufacturer. This experience provided valuable insights into precision craftsmanship, attention to detail, and sound quality — all of which continue to influence my work as a guitar maker.
